
Check out the official trailer for Fountain of Youth! Streaming on AppleTV+ May 23, 2025.
Two estranged siblings partner on a global heist to find the mythological Fountain of Youth. They must use their knowledge of history to follow clues on an epic adventure that will change their lives — and possibly lead to immortality.
